external WG on 16g?
 
what do you think about it? and im looking at this: http://stores.punishment-racing.com/...ial/Detail.bok im wondering about it being 2.5 inch, they have this one which is to ATM and they have one that is recirc, would it be better going with this one cause of the 2.5 inch? or should i just stay with my internally gated ported 02 housing setup?

TheEngineer 11-23-2009 06:42 AM

they kinda name it wrong. Its not really externally gated on that its just being dumped to the ATM. your turbo will still be internally gated. The only thing this will do is maybe relieve some pressure and make it very loud. unless your having problems with boost spikes and creep then i wouldnt bother, unless you wont that loud sound

no that flange is for where that dump pipe (as shown in the pic, dumps to) the wastegate cant be mounted on the o2 housing, it has to be prior to the compressor housing of a turbo, which is why this is only for internally gated turbos that want to dump. Although i guess this may possibly work for an external gate, but you would have to remove the actuator and wastegate in the turbo first. But like i said, it will make it loud. Depending on where you live and how the cops are you may or may not want to do this.

But yes it will allow for better flow. But nothing that i could see as a huge gain for your setup
